Label Specification
Model Number 1756 – TBNH – A
Brand Allen – Bradley (Rockwell Automation)
Type Removable Terminal Block (RTB) Module
Mounting Plugs into the front of 1756 I/O modules
Number of Positions 20 – position NEMA screw – clamp
Wire Compatibility Accepts solid or stranded copper wire of 0.33 – 2.1 mm² (22 – 14 AWG), all of the same type (no mixing of solid and stranded)
Rated Temperature for Wiring 90 °C (194 °F) or higher
Maximum Insulation Thickness for Wiring 1.2 mm (3/64 inch)
Screw Torque 1.36 Nm
Maximum Screwdriver Width 8 millimeters (5/16 inches)
Dimensions 5.51 x 4.41 x 5.71 inches
Weight 0.3 pounds
Operating Temperature 0 – 60 °C
Operating Shock Can withstand 30g working shock
Backplane Current (5 volts) 1200 milliamps
Backplane Current (24 volts) 2.5 milliamps
Power Dissipation (max) 6.19 watts

The Allen – Bradley 1756 – TBNH – A is engineered with functionality and durability in mind. Its 20 – position NEMA screw – clamp design allows for a secure and stable connection of wires. The ability to use either solid or stranded wires within the specified gauge range provides flexibility in wiring choices, although it’s important to note that only one type of wire can be used throughout the terminal block. This design choice ensures consistent electrical conductivity and mechanical stability, reducing the risk of loose connections that could lead to signal interference or equipment malfunctions.
